DYNAMIC SELECT button

Function of the DYNAMIC SELECT button
* NOTE Mercedes-AMG vehicles
Observe the notes in the Supplement.
#
You could otherwise fail to recognize
dangers.
You can switch between the drive programs with
the DYNAMIC SELECT button (
page 185).
/
Depending on the drive program selected, the fol-
lowing vehicle characteristics will change:

Available drive programs
= (Individual)
The following vehicle characteristics are indi-
R
vidually adjustable:
Drive
-
Suspension
-
Steering
-
®
-
ESP
Sound of the drive system in the vehicle
-
interior
C (Sport)
Sporty and dynamic driving characteristics
R
Only suitable for good road conditions, a dry
R
road surface and a clear stretch of road
A (Comfort)
Comfortable driving style
R
Recommended for all road conditions
R
Best balance between efficiency and perform-
R
ance for all driving situations
; (Eco)
Economical setting of vehicle functions
R
Recommended for all road conditions
R
Additional first point of resistance in the hap-
R
tic accelerator pedal indicates an efficient,
economical driving style
®
settings in the drive programs ;
The ESP
and A are designed for stability. Therefore,
choose one of these drive programs especially
when transporting roof loads, in trailer operation
and when the vehicle is fully loaded or fully occu-
pied.
